Gynecomastia surgery, also known as male breast reduction surgery, is a medical procedure designed to remove excess glandular tissue and fat from the male chest. It is a common treatment for gynecomastia, a condition where men develop enlarged breasts due to hormonal imbalances, obesity, steroid use, or certain medications. Gynecomastia Surgery: Procedure & Techniques

Types of Gynecomastia Surgery

There are two main types of procedures used to treat gynecomastia:

  1. Liposuction Surgery
    • Best suited for cases caused by excess fat (pseudogynecomastia).
    • Uses small incisions to remove fat with suction cannulas.
    • Minimal scarring and quick recovery.
  2. Glandular Tissue Excision
    • Ideal for cases with excess glandular tissue.
    • Involves making an incision around the areola to remove the glandular tissue.
    • Provides a more contoured chest appearance.

Step-by-Step Surgical Procedure

  1. Consultation & Diagnosis – The surgeon evaluates the severity and underlying cause of gynecomastia.
  2. Pre-Surgery Preparation – Blood tests, stopping certain medications, and avoiding smoking/alcohol before surgery.
  3. Anesthesia Administration – Local or general anesthesia is used.
  4. Surgical Procedure – Liposuction, glandular excision, or a combination of both is performed.
  5. Closure & Bandaging – Incisions are stitched, and compression garments are applied.
  6. Recovery & Follow-up – Patients must follow post-surgery care guidelines for optimal healing.

FAQs About Gynecomastia Surgery

1. Is gynecomastia surgery painful?

Mild discomfort is expected post-surgery, but pain medication helps manage it.

2. How long does the surgery take?

The procedure typically lasts between 1-2 hours.

3. What is the success rate of gynecomastia surgery?

Gynecomastia surgery has a high success rate of over 90% with permanent results.

4. Can gynecomastia return after surgery?

In most cases, the results are permanent. However, excessive weight gain or steroid use can cause recurrence.

5. How do I know if I need gynecomastia surgery?

If you have persistent chest enlargement despite exercise and diet changes, consult a specialist for evaluation.
